你查询的IP:[116.4.19.8]  地理位置:中国–广东–东莞

最新查询202.149.160.143 123.96.223.9 122.202.64.223 119.19.6.196 218.64.46.196 221.136.175.73 122.4.145.192 210.5.244.14 119.11.240.102 116.4.19.8 203.208.32.123 121.16.16.217 203.119.24.83 220.232.64.179 124.254.50.143 210.32.94.167 167.139.11.32 121.51.241.80 121.40.178.138 210.5.144.87 125.64.4.139 203.119.24.230 221.199.146.233 161.207.244.235 125.112.22.110 202.125.176.24 123.64.35.234 60.55.138.206 116.214.64.30 202.90.224.48 117.58.18.244